Problem #15\r
\n" ); document.write( "
\n" ); document.write( "\n" ); document.write( "\n" ); document.write( "\n" ); document.write( "
NumberStatementLines UsedReason
1(~D v E) & (~D v ~F)
2(E & ~F) -> ~G
3~D -> ~G
:.~G
4~D v E1Simp
5~D v ~F1Simp
6D -> E4MI
7D -> ~F5MI
8E -> (~F -> ~G)2Exp
9D -> (~F -> ~G)6,8HS
10(D & ~F) -> ~G9Exp
11(~F & D) -> ~G10Comm
12~F -> (D -> ~G)11Exp
13D - > (D -> ~G)7,12HS
14(D & D) -> ~G13Exp
15D -> ~G14Taut
16G -> D3Trans
17G -> ~G16,15HS
18~G v ~G17MI
19~G18Taut
\r
\n" ); document.write( "
\n" ); document.write( "\n" ); document.write( "Abbreviations Used:\r
\n" ); document.write( "
\n" ); document.write( "\n" ); document.write( "Comm: Commutation
\n" ); document.write( "Exp: Exportation
\n" ); document.write( "HS: Hypothetical Syllogism
\n" ); document.write( "MI: Material Implication
\n" ); document.write( "Simp: Simplification
\n" ); document.write( "Taut: Tautology
\n" ); document.write( "Trans: Transposition\r

\n" ); document.write( "\n" ); document.write( "Problem #24\r
\n" ); document.write( "
\n" ); document.write( "\n" ); document.write( "\n" ); document.write( "\n" ); document.write( "
NumberStatementLines UsedReason
1~O
:.~Q -> ~(O & P)
2~O v Q1Add
3Q v ~O2Comm
4(Q v ~O) v ~P3Add
5~(~Q & O) v ~P4DM
6(~Q & O) -> ~P5MI
7~Q -> (O -> ~P)6Exp
8~Q -> (~O v ~P)7MI
9~Q -> ~(O & P)8DM
\r
\n" ); document.write( "
\n" ); document.write( "\n" ); document.write( "Abbreviations Used:\r
\n" ); document.write( "\n" ); document.write( "Add: Addition
\n" ); document.write( "Comm: Commutation
\n" ); document.write( "DM: De Morgan's Law
\n" ); document.write( "Exp: Exportation
\n" ); document.write( "MI: Material Implication
